One of the key components of electric linear motion technology is the linear actuator. This device is responsible for converting rotational motion into linear motion, providing the necessary force to move objects in a controlled manner. Linear actuators come in various types, including ball screw, lead screw, belt drive, and rack and pinion, each with its own advantages and applications.

Ball screw actuators are widely used in applications that require high precision and smooth operation. These actuators consist of a ball screw and a nut, where the nut moves along the screw as it rotates. Ball screw actuators offer high efficiency and minimal backlash, making them ideal for tasks such as positioning systems, robotic arms, and CNC machines.

Lead screw actuators, on the other hand, are more cost-effective and simpler in design compared to ball screw actuators. These actuators are suitable for applications that do not require high precision but still need reliable linear motion. Lead screw actuators are commonly used in lifting systems, medical devices, and agricultural equipment.

Belt drive actuators utilize a belt and pulley system to transmit motion from the motor to the load. These actuators are known for their high speed and quiet operation, making them ideal for applications such as packaging machines, 3D printers, and automation systems. Belt drive actuators are also easy to install and maintain, providing a cost-effective solution for linear motion needs.

Rack and pinion actuators are used in applications that require high force and fast speeds. These actuators consist of a rack (linear gear) and a pinion (rotational gear), where the pinion drives the rack to produce linear motion. Rack and pinion actuators are commonly found in industrial robots, material handling equipment, and automotive systems due to their high efficiency and reliability.
